JVP to hold protest fast on Feb 08 for Fonseka

February 6, 2011   04:05 pm

The Janatha Vimukthi Peramuna says that they will organize an immense protest fast on February 08 in front of the Welikada Prison to commemorate the nearing of one year since the imprisonment of former Army Chief Sarath Fonseka.


Everybody putting aside party differences should join the protest fast, which being held by the initiation of the ‘People’s Movement for Democracy’, JVP Properganda Secretary Vijitha Herath pointed out. 


Speking during a press briefing today (February 06) he said that decisions have to be taken separately whither struggles against various issues should be carried out jointly or separately.
